Output 115d29d66577a28d42b593768fbea3c1202abd47169b7011b822d73ee9fb533e:1

value
6388696
script pubkey
OP_0 OP_PUSHBYTES_20 e5dd0ebbb4f730865af07673998180a68ce5a758
address
ltc1quhwsawa57ucgvkhsweeenqvq56xwtf6c463lkw
transaction
115d29d66577a28d42b593768fbea3c1202abd47169b7011b822d73ee9fb533e
spent
true